About Barangay Cadacad
Barangay Cadacad forms part of Nagbukel, a municipality in Ilocos Sur, and is classified as a very small barangay.
According to the 2020 Philippine census, Barangay Cadacad had a population of 230. This made it the 11th largest of 12 barangays in Nagbukel by population, placing it among the smaller barangays of the municipality. Residents of Barangay Cadacad accounted for approximately 4.21% of the total population of Nagbukel, which stood at 5,465 in the same census year.
Census comparisons between 2015 and 2020 show Barangay Cadacad moving from 237 residents to 230 residents, an intercensal change of -3.0%. The trajectory indicates a contracting community. Barangay Cadacad is officially classified as rural, a designation applied to barangays with lower population density and predominantly non-built-up land use.
Nagbukel is a municipality comprising 12 barangays, and serves as the governing unit directly responsible for local services in Barangay Cadacad, including public health, sanitation, peace and order, and civil registration. Within the wider province of Ilocos Sur, which contains 768 barangays across its component cities and municipalities, Barangay Cadacad ranks 741st by 2020 population. Ilocos Sur is classified as a 1st by the Bureau of Local Government Finance, a category that reflects the province's annual regular income.
Barangay Cadacad is governed by an elected Sangguniang Barangay composed of a Punong Barangay and seven kagawads, with the Sangguniang Kabataan representing the youth. The next BSKE, set for Monday, November 2, 2026, will elect officials to four-year terms as provided under Republic Act No. 12232.
